A beautiful summer salad featuring fresh peaches, creamy burrata cheese, basil, pine nuts, and a balsamic glaze.

Peach Burrata Platter

A refreshing and elegant salad perfect for summer gatherings.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ings: 6 people
Course: Appetizer, Salad
Cuisine: Italian

Ingredients
  

For the Salad
  • 2 balls burrata cheese room temperature
  • 3 ripe peaches pitted and sliced
  • 1/2 cup fresh basil leaves torn
  • 1/4 cup toasted pine nuts
For the Dressing
  • 3 tbsp olive oil extra virgin
  • 1 tbsp balsamic glaze
  • 1 tsp honey
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/8 tsp black pepper freshly ground

Equipment

  • Serving platter
  • Small bowl

Method
 

  1. Arrange the burrata balls and sliced peaches on a serving platter.
  2. Scatter the torn basil leaves and toasted pine nuts over the peaches and burrata.
  3. In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, balsamic glaze, honey, salt, and pepper for the dressing.
  4. Drizzle the dressing over the platter just before serving.

Notes

You can substitute nectarines or plums for peaches if they are in season.
